Jaguar Land Rover has told workers to stay home until Tuesday while it deals with the fallout of a cyber attack. The weekend breach forced the automaker to switch off critical IT systems. That action disrupted both production and car sales. Factories in Halewood, Solihull, and Wolverhampton remain closed. Managers say the suspension could last longer as reviews continue. sales and operations under pressure Car sales have faced major disruption, though some transactions still went through, according to people close to the situation. Labour could deliver on its pledge to end badger culling, but only with a major increase in testing and vaccination, according to a government-commissioned review. The report, led by Sir Charles Godfray, warns that current investment levels in tackling bovine tuberculosis (bTB) are insufficient, giving ministers only a “small chance” of eradicating the disease in England by 2038. More than 210,000 badgers have been killed since culling began in 2013, with the disease costing taxpayers and farmers around £150m each year. Donald Trump has asked the US Supreme Court to rescue his tariff measures. He wants the justices to overturn a ruling that declared his sweeping duties unlawful. Dispute over presidential authority The administration filed its petition on Wednesday night. It asks the court to decide quickly whether a president can impose tariffs without Congress. Last week, the Federal Circuit Court of Appeals ruled 7-4 against Trump. Judges stressed that the authority to set import duties belongs only to Congress. An electric streetcar in Lisbon derailed on Wednesday, killing at least 15 people and injuring 18 more. Portuguese television showed the yellow-and-white vehicle overturned on its narrow hillside track. The crash happened around 6 pm during the busy evening rush hour. Emergency Crews Work at the Scene The impact crumpled the top and sides of the funicular, leaving wreckage strewn across the road. Dozens of emergency workers rushed to the site to rescue passengers and secure the area. Local media reported that officials have not yet identified the cause of the disaster. The Lancashire Wildlife Trust (LWT) has begun a drive to reintroduce three rare species—the large heath butterfly, bog bush cricket, and white-faced darter dragonfly—once common across Lancashire and Greater Manchester’s peat bogs. These insects rely on lowland peatlands, 96% of which have been lost due to human activity. LWT has been restoring habitats through peatland rehabilitation, rebuilding water systems, and replanting specialist vegetation, and is now appealing for £20,000 to complete the project. “These insects play vital roles in the ecosystem,” the trust said, noting their importance for pollination, decomposition, and controlling invertebrate populations. Residents in Dupnitsa claimed to see a black panther, sparking a police investigation and online memes. The search continues for the elusive creature. A villager filmed a dark animal he believed to be the dangerous feline. Mayor Desislav Nachov inspected the site with police officers after the footage emerged. Police questioned the witness, whose video showed a large black animal moving through tall grass. Nachov said authorities have not decided whether to open an emergency search base. The US government’s case against Google’s dominance in online search has sparked global debate. Not since Microsoft faced trial in 1998 has Big Tech felt so exposed. One year after Judge Amit Mehta declared Google a monopolist, he issued remedies that some dismiss as weak while others argue they could still matter. Google escapes the harshest penalty During the remedies phase, many anticipated a forced split. Judge Mehta rejected calls to spin off Chrome, the world’s most popular browser. Trump calls strike a message to traffickers President Donald Trump confirmed Tuesday that American military units carried out a strike against a vessel reportedly tied to Venezuela’s Tren de Aragua cartel, resulting in 11 deaths. The operation occurred in international waters in the southern Caribbean, officials said. Secretary of State Marco Rubio described the boat as part of a drug-smuggling route from Venezuela and said the strike was intended to disrupt cartel activities across the region. OpenAI introduced new parental controls for ChatGPT after a lawsuit from the parents of Adam Raine. Sixteen-year-old Adam died by suicide in April, and his parents sued OpenAI and CEO Sam Altman. They alleged ChatGPT fostered psychological dependence, encouraged Adam’s suicide plan, and even drafted a farewell note. OpenAI promised to release parental controls within a month, allowing parents to supervise children’s ChatGPT use. The company said parents could link accounts, restrict features, and view chat history and memory functions.
